Arthur’s Tavern | 237 Washington Street *CURRENTLY REMODELING*
A Hoboken staple known for their divine steaks, Arthur’s is also serving up some ah-mazing garlic bread {it’s even labeled on their menu as their “famous” – for good reason}. Enjoy it as an appetizer to share, or order one of your own and pair it with a bowl of chili — you just can’t go wrong.
Urban Coalhouse | 116 14th Street
Urban Coalhouse is known for its killer brick-oven pizza and wings, and the garlic bread definitely doesn’t disappoint, either. This is not your average garlic bread as it is on pizza crust…that’s correct. It’s basically a garlic bread pizza and it. is. GOOD.
Tony Boloney’s | 263 First Street
If you’re looking for a not-so-traditional spin on garlic bread, Tony Boloney’s is obv your spot. Sure, they have your regular cheesy garlic bread, but they also have some crazy creations — like the “Ay Dios Mio-Mac Garlic Bread” {cheesy mac n’ cheese garlic bread topped with chipotle house sauce + cilantro} — sign us up.

Antique Bar & Bakery | 122 Willow Avenue
This old-school Hoboken bread bakery-turned-restaurant is serving up some of the best food in town — from steaks to pasta to fish and beyond. If you’re dining at Antique, you’re prob not there for the garlic bread, but think again because, well, just look at it {pre-oven shot pictured above}.

Benny Tudino’s | 622 Washington Street

^^^ The real star of the show at Benny’s, obvi, but trust us, their garlic bread is not something to pass up on {especially with mozz on it}
If you find yourself at Benny’s for a slice of their huuuge {and delish} pizza, pair it with some of their appetizers like wings, antipasto, mussels, or of course, the star of the show today, garlic bread. Their garlic bread is available with or without cheese and is the ultimate comfort food {ask for it with a side of marinara for some extra yum — you’re welcome}.
Margherita’s | 740 Washington Street
Margherita’s is a fan-favorite here in Hoboken and it offers not only garlic bread, but also garlic bread with mozzarella. Say no more.
